Boxwood pruning services involve the careful trimming and shaping of boxwood shrubs to maintain their health and aesthetic appeal. These services typically include removing dead or damaged branches, thinning out overgrown areas, and shaping the shrub to achieve a desired form. Proper pruning encourages dense growth, helps maintain a uniform appearance, and can prevent the shrub from becoming overly leggy or unruly. Skilled professionals use specialized tools and techniques to ensure the pruning process promotes healthy growth while preserving the natural form of the plant.
Pruning boxwoods can address several common issues, such as overgrowth, disease, and pest infestations. Overgrown boxwoods may obstruct pathways or reduce visibility, while damaged or diseased branches can weaken the plant and make it more susceptible to further health problems. Regular pruning also helps improve air circulation within the shrub, reducing the risk of fungal infections. Additionally, shaping the boxwood can enhance curb appeal and ensure it fits harmoniously within the landscape design of a property.

Why should I consider pruning my boxwoods? Regular pruning helps maintain the desired shape, promotes healthy growth, and prevents disease in boxwood shrubs.
When is the best time to prune boxwoods? The ideal time for pruning is during the late winter to early spring, before new growth begins.
How do professional services handle boxwood pruning? Local service providers typically assess the shrub's condition, then carefully trim to enhance appearance and health.
Are there different pruning techniques for boxwoods? Yes, techniques vary depending on the desired shape and shrub health, including shaping, thinning, and rejuvenation pruning.
Can pruning help prevent common boxwood issues? Proper pruning can improve air circulation and remove damaged or diseased branches, reducing the risk of pests and diseases.
